Located in Downtown San Antonio, Hampton Inn & Suites San Antonio Riverwalk is adjacent to San Antonio River and within a 5-minute walk of other popular sights like San Antonio Majestic Theater. This 122-room hotel has conveniences like free breakfast, an outdoor pool, and free in-room WiFi.
Free on-the-go breakfast is served on weekdays from 6:00 AM to 9:00 AM and on weekends from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M.
Guests can expect to find free WiFi and wired Internet, along with 50-inch flat-screen TVs. Bathrooms offer hair dryers and designer toiletries. Free local calls, ceiling fans, and ironing boards are also standard. Weekly housekeeping is available.
Guests staying at Hampton Inn & Suites San Antonio Riverwalk enjoy an outdoor pool, a gym, and free WiFi in public areas. Valet parking is available for USD 49.00 per night. The 24-hour front desk has staff standing by to help with dry cleaning/laundry, luggage storage, and securing valuables. Additional amenities include a business center, coffee/tea in a common area, and express check-in.
